# DoH Forwarder — Project Plan ## Overview A lightweight dual-protocol DNS forwarder written in Rust. It accepts DNS queries over both traditional DNS (UDP/TCP) and DNS-over-HTTPS (RFC 8484), then forwards them upstream via DoH (HTTPS POST) to configurable resolvers. ## Goals - Accept DoH queries over HTTP (GET and POST per RFC 8484) - Accept traditional DNS queries over UDP and TCP - Forward all queries to upstream DoH resolvers via HTTPS POST - Support multiple upstream resolvers with round-robin or failover selection - TOML configuration with environment variable overrides - Graceful shutdown on SIGINT/SIGTERM - Health-check endpoint - Low resource footprint, single binary ## Architecture ```mermaid flowchart LR subgraph clients["Clients"] browser["Browser / App"] os["OS DNS Client"] end subgraph forwarder["DoH Forwarder"] doh["/dns-query (HTTP)"] health["/health"] dns["DNS Listener (UDP/TCP)"] upstream["Upstream Client"] end subgraph upstreams["Upstream DoH Resolvers"] cf["Cloudflare (1.1.1.1)"] google["Google (8.8.8.8)"] other["..."] end browser -- "HTTPS (RFC 8484)" --> doh os -- "UDP/TCP :5353" --> dns doh --> upstream dns --> upstream upstream -- "HTTPS POST" --> cf upstream -- "HTTPS POST" --> google upstream -- "HTTPS POST" --> other cf -- "DNS response" --> upstream google -- "DNS response" --> upstream other -- "DNS response" --> upstream ``` ## Tech Stack - **Language**: Rust - **HTTP server**: Axum - **DNS wire-format**: hickory-proto - **HTTP client**: reqwest (with rustls-tls) - **Async runtime**: Tokio - **Config**: TOML (config file) + env vars - **Logging**: tracing + tracing-subscriber (env-filter) - **Error handling**: thiserror, anyhow - **Encoding**: base64 ## Milestones ### M1 — Core Forwarding ✅ - [x] Project scaffold (Cargo.toml, src layout) - [x] HTTP server with `/dns-query` endpoint (GET + POST per RFC 8484) - [x] Parse incoming DNS wire-format queries (hickory-proto) - [x] Forward to upstream DoH resolver via HTTPS POST - [x] Return DNS wire-format response - [x] Health endpoint (`GET /health`) - [x] SERVFAIL response when upstream fails - [x] Integration tests (tests/integration.rs) ### M2 — Multiple Upstreams & Config ✅ - [x] TOML config file support (config/default.toml) - [x] Multiple upstream resolver support - [x] Upstream selection strategy (round-robin / failover) - [x] Automatic retry with next resolver on failure - [x] Environment variable overrides (DOH_LISTEN, DOH_UPSTREAM_STRATEGY, DOH_UPSTREAM_RESOLVERS) - [x] Graceful shutdown (SIGINT / SIGTERM) ### M3 — Local DNS Listener ✅ - [x] UDP listener on configurable port (default 5353) - [x] TCP listener on configurable port (default 5353) - [x] DNS over TCP with 2-byte length prefix (RFC 1035 §4.2.2) - [x] Forward through DoH pipeline (shared upstream client) - [x] Return DNS wire-format response over UDP/TCP - [x] Config: `[dns]` section with `listen` address - [ ] Integration test with UDP/TCP clients ### M4 — Caching - [ ] In-memory DNS response cache - [ ] Cache key = (query name, query type) - [ ] Respect DNS response TTL (with configurable max) - [ ] Cache eviction (TTL-based + LRU size cap) - [ ] Cache stats endpoint (`/cache/stats`) ### M5 — Observability - [ ] Request logging middleware (query name, type, latency, upstream used) - [ ] Metrics endpoint (Prometheus format) ### M6 — Blocking & Filtering - [ ] Domain blocklist (file-based, one domain per line) - [ ] Wildcard / suffix matching - [ ] Return NXDOMAIN for blocked queries - [ ] Hot-reload blocklist on SIGHUP ### M7 — Production Hardening - [ ] Rate limiting (per-IP) - [ ] Dockerfile (multi-stage, distroless) - [ ] Helm chart - [ ] CI pipeline (lint, test, build, image push) ### M8 — Censorship Resistance (the real differentiator) This is where the project goes beyond what `cloudflared` offers. See [story.md](story.md) for the full rationale. - [ ] SOCKS5 proxy support for upstream DoH connections - [ ] HTTP CONNECT proxy support for upstream DoH connections - [ ] Configurable upstream transport (direct / SOCKS5 / WireGuard tunnel) - [ ] Upstream health probing (latency + availability) - [ ] Auto-switch away from unreachable resolvers ## Directory Structure ``` doh-forwarder/ ├── Cargo.toml ├── config/ │ └── default.toml ├── src/ │ ├── main.rs # entrypoint, server setup, graceful shutdown │ ├── lib.rs # public API re-exports │ ├── config.rs # TOML config parsing + env var overrides │ ├── routes.rs # HTTP route handlers (/dns-query, /health) │ ├── dns/ │ │ ├── mod.rs │ │ ├── query.rs # DNS wire-format query parsing │ │ ├── response.rs # DNS response building (SERVFAIL) │ │ └── listener.rs # UDP/TCP DNS listener │ └── upstream/ │ ├── mod.rs │ └── doh_client.rs # DoH forwarding client (retry, strategies) └── tests/ └── integration.rs # HTTP integration tests ``` ## Non-Goals (for now) - DNS-over-TLS (DoT) listener - DNSSEC validation - Persistent cache (Redis / disk) - Web UI / dashboard
